ceph-0002: BlueStore::_do_remove — O(E×U) std::find over unshared_blobs vector

CWE-407 — Algorithmic Complexity

Field Value
ID ceph-0002
Severity MEDIUM
Ecosystem Ceph
File src/os/bluestore/BlueStore.cc
Lines 1809918115 (function BlueStore::_do_remove)
Complexity O(E×U) where E = extents per object, U = unshared blobs
Hot path Object deletion — every rados rm, RGW object delete, CephFS unlink

Defect

In BlueStore::_do_remove(), after computing which shared blobs can be "unshared" (because the object being deleted was the last reference), the code iterates the object's full extent map and for each extent calls std::find over the unshared_blobs vector to check membership:

vector<SharedBlob*> unshared_blobs;
unshared_blobs.reserve(maybe_unshared_blobs.size());
for (auto& p : expect) {
    if (p.first->persistent->ref_map == p.second) {
        SharedBlob *sb = p.first;
        unshared_blobs.push_back(sb);           // U entries
        ...
    }
}

if (unshared_blobs.empty()) {
    return 0;
}

// Scan every extent in the object to clear just-unshared blobs
for (auto& e : h->extent_map.extent_map) {          // O(E) loop
    const bluestore_blob_t& b = e.blob->get_blob();
    SharedBlob *sb = e.blob->get_shared_blob().get();
    if (b.is_shared() &&
        std::find(unshared_blobs.begin(), unshared_blobs.end(),  // O(U) scan
                  sb) != unshared_blobs.end()) {
        bluestore_blob_t& blob = e.blob->dirty_blob();
        blob.clear_flag(bluestore_blob_t::FLAG_SHARED);
        ...
    }
}

unshared_blobs is a vector<SharedBlob*> and membership is tested with std::find — O(U) per extent. Total cost: O(E × U).

Typical sizes:

  • A 1 GiB RGW object with 4 KiB blocks: E ≈ 262,144 extents
  • A highly-shared object with many clones: U can reach tens of thousands
  • Product: billions of pointer comparisons per delete

Even for moderate objects (E=10,000, U=100): 1,000,000 comparisons that could be 100 with a hash set.

Fix

Replace vector<SharedBlob*> unshared_blobs with unordered_set<SharedBlob*> unshared_set for O(1) lookup:

// CWE-407 fix: use an unordered_set for O(1) membership test
std::unordered_set<SharedBlob*> unshared_set;
unshared_set.reserve(maybe_unshared_blobs.size());

for (auto& p : expect) {
    dout(20) << " ? " << *p.first << " vs " << p.second << dendl;
    if (p.first->persistent->ref_map == p.second) {
        SharedBlob *sb = p.first;
        dout(20) << __func__ << "  unsharing " << *sb << dendl;
        unshared_set.insert(sb);
        txc->unshare_blob(sb);
        uint64_t sbid = c->make_blob_unshared(sb);
        string key;
        get_shared_blob_key(sbid, &key);
        txc->t->rmkey(PREFIX_SHARED_BLOB, key);
    }
}

if (unshared_set.empty()) {
    return 0;
}

// And now a run through .head extents to clear up freshly unshared blobs.
for (auto& e : h->extent_map.extent_map) {
    const bluestore_blob_t& b = e.blob->get_blob();
    SharedBlob *sb = e.blob->get_shared_blob().get();
    if (b.is_shared() &&
        unshared_set.count(sb)) {                            // O(1) lookup
        dout(20) << __func__ << "  unsharing " << e << dendl;
        bluestore_blob_t& blob = e.blob->dirty_blob();
        blob.clear_flag(bluestore_blob_t::FLAG_SHARED);
        e.blob->get_dirty_shared_blob() = nullptr;
        h->extent_map.dirty_range(e.logical_offset, e.length);
    }
}
txc->write_onode(h);

return 0;

Required include: #include <unordered_set> (already available via #include "include/ceph_hash.h" or add directly).

Speedup

Extents (E) Unshared (U) Before After Ratio
1,000 10 10,000 1,000 10×
10,000 100 1,000,000 10,000 100×
262,144 1,000 262,144,000 262,144 1,000×

At E=262,144 (1 GiB object, 4 KiB blocks) and U=1,000 shared blobs the speedup is ~1,000× — the delete operation goes from O(billions of pointer comparisons) to O(262,144 hash lookups).

Notes

The maybe_unshared_blobs source set at line 18010 is already a set<SharedBlob*> (ordered), so it inherently avoids duplicates. The subsequent unshared_blobs vector was needlessly downgraded to linear-scan membership. Converting to unordered_set restores O(1) lookup without any correctness risk — SharedBlob* pointer equality is the intended comparison.
